Copiapoa Tenuissima is a small, clustering cactus species native to the coastal areas of northern Chile. It has pale green to grayish stems, usually covered with a fine layer of woolly white hair, which helps protect it from the sun. The plant produces yellow, funnel-shaped flowers that bloom in summer.

Bare Root Shipping
All plants are typically shipped bare-rooted, meaning that the soil is carefully removed from the roots to prevent any damage during transit. We wash the roots to remove any remaining soil and allow them to dry before wrapping them gently in tissue paper. This process helps minimize stress on the plant and ensures its safe arrival to you.
Pot Shipping Option (Not Recommended)
While we do offer the option of shipping some plants in their pots, this is generally not advisable. Shipping a plant in its pot can result in root damage due to movement and stress during transit. The roots can become constricted or disturbed, which can harm the plant. If you are still interested in this option, it must be arranged in advance with the vendor, and we will take extra precautions to pack it as securely as possible. However, we highly recommend the bare-root shipping method to ensure the best possible outcome for your plant.

Aloe erinacea (Hedgehog Aloe)
A rare and highly sought-after miniature aloe, Aloe erinacea is prized for its compact, solitary rosette and bold, architectural form. Its thick, dark green leaves are densely covered in prominent white spines, giving it a striking “hedgehog” appearance. This slow-growing species stays small, making it perfect for collectors and display in limited spaces.
Thriving in bright light and well-draining soil, it requires minimal watering and rewards patience with its unique, sculptural beauty.
Interesting fact:
Aloe erinacea is endemic to Namibia and is specially adapted to survive in extremely arid conditions, using its dense spines to help shade the plant and reduce water loss.SKU: n/a -

Mammillaria theresae is a rare and highly sought-after miniature cactus native to the rocky slopes of Durango, Mexico. It is known for its compact size, dense white spines, and stunning pink to magenta flowers that bloom in spring. This slow-growing species thrives in well-draining soil, bright indirect sunlight, and minimal watering. To prevent root rot, allow the soil to dry completely between waterings. Mammillaria theresae prefers warm temperatures and should be protected from frost.

Ariocarpus retusus is a slow-growing, rare cactus native to the limestone-rich regions of Mexico. Known for its unique, rosette-shaped growth, it has triangular, smooth, gray-green tubercles that give it a stone-like appearance. It produces stunning white or pale pink flowers, typically in autumn, making it a sought-after species among collectors. This drought-tolerant plant thrives in well-draining soil and requires minimal water, making it ideal for xerophytic gardening.

Copiapoa hypogaea ‘Lizard Skin’ is a rare and highly collectible cactus variety native to the Atacama Desert in northern Chile. This cultivar is known for its rough, textured epidermis that resembles lizard skin—giving it a unique, reptilian appearance. It forms small, flattened globular bodies that grow low to the ground, often clustering over time.
The plant is usually spineless or has very short, dark spines. In summer, it may produce pale yellow flowers from the crown. Like other Copiapoa species, it prefers full sun, excellent drainage, and very minimal watering—especially in cooler months.

Crassula Tecta is a compact, slow-growing succulent admired for its thick, triangular leaves covered in a silvery-grey, textured coating. Its sculptural appearance makes it a standout in any succulent collection. This hardy plant prefers bright light and well-drained soil, making it ideal for containers, rock gardens, and dry landscapes.
